Time Calculation is Incorrect for Rate Service Using Simulation with Distance Defined in KPH (Doc ID 2204567.1)

Last updated on MARCH 16, 2017

Applies to:

Oracle Transportation Management - Version 6.2.10 to 6.4.3 [Release 6.2 to 6.4]
Oracle Transportation Operational Planning - Version 6.2.10 to 6.4.3 [Release 6.2 to 6.4]
Information in this document applies to any platform.

Symptoms

Drive time calculation is incorrect using a Rate Service Type of SIMULATION with the speed defined in KPH.

Test Case:

Rate service is defined with the following distance and speed range.

250.00 KM- 25.00 KPH

When doing a distance/time calculation with Distance and ServiceTime logging enabled we see this:

2016-10-20 09:25:34.265 729426 Debug Distance Distance = Distance Type: ESTIMATE, Distance UOM: 108.01 MI, isEstimated: true [[ACTIVE] ExecuteThread: '2' for queue: 'weblogic.kernel.Default (self-tuning)']
2016-10-20 09:25:34.265 729426 Debug ServiceTime Speed = 15. [[ACTIVE] ExecuteThread: '2' for queue: 'weblogic.kernel.Default (self-tuning)']

Note: The base UOM for Distance in OTM is set to MPH. Any distance being evaluated is converted to MPH before the distance is calculated.

25 KPH / 1.60934 = 15.53 MPH

Per the logs OTM is using 15 and not the expected value 15.53

 

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ms